一、服务器与网络优化
服务器作为网站运行的核心,其配置直接影响带宽利用率。建议优先选择云托管服务,通过弹性扩展机制应对流量峰值,同时将服务器部署在靠近主要用户群体的地理位置。对于高并发场景,采用负载均衡技术可有效分散请求压力,避免单节点过载。
二、资源压缩与分发
通过以下技术手段减少数据传输量:
- 启用Gzip压缩文本资源(HTML/CSS/JS),可减少70%文件体积
- 使用WebP格式替代传统图片格式,压缩率提升30%
- 部署CDN网络,将静态资源缓存至边缘节点,降低源站带宽压力
三、缓存策略实施
合理设置缓存策略可显著减少重复请求:
- 配置浏览器缓存头(Cache-Control),设置静态资源长期缓存
- 建立Redis或Memcached服务器缓存层,缓存数据库查询结果
- 对API响应添加ETag标识,实现304协商缓存
四、代码与数据库优化
前端代码优化方面,建议合并CSS/JS文件减少HTTP请求,采用异步加载非关键资源。数据库层面需定期执行索引优化,清理冗余数据,对于复杂查询建议添加查询缓存。
综合运用网络层优化、资源压缩、智能缓存三大策略,可在不增加硬件投入的情况下有效缓解带宽瓶颈。实际实施时应通过Chrome DevTools和WebPageTest等工具持续监测优化效果,形成性能调优闭环。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/632072.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。